Roughing It on the Oregon Trail

Diane Stanley (2000), 48 pages
Illustrated by Holly Berry
Audience: 2nd Grade - 4th Grade
When the twins, Lenny and Elizabeth, visit their grandmother while their parents take a trip to Paris, they're in for a surprise! Their grandmother has the power to travel through time with her magic hat, and the twins choose to meet their great-great-great-great-grandmother Elizabeth in 1843, while she was moving west on the Oregon Trail. So they join their relatives from long ago on a great journey in a covered wagon, seeing many things for the first time, like buffalo and the Soda Springs. Read this picture-filled book to find out about the rest of their trip and how it ended!
